In today's rapidly evolving world, it is crucial to equip our children with the skills and knowledge needed to thrive in the 21st century. Traditional education focused on science, technology, engineering, arts, and mathematics (STEM) has been expanded to incorporate the arts, resulting in STEAM education. This innovative approach integrates creativity, critical thinking, and problem-solving skills into the core subjects, providing students with a well-rounded education. In this article, we will explore the benefits of STEAM education and how it prepares students for success in various aspects of life.

1. Building a Strong Foundation in STEM
STEAM education places a strong emphasis on science, technology, engineering, and mathematics, providing students with a solid foundation in these disciplines. By integrating arts into STEM, students are encouraged to think creatively, exploring connections between different subjects and fostering a holistic approach to learning.

2. Encouraging Creativity and Innovation
By incorporating arts into the curriculum, STEAM education nurtures students' creativity and innovation. The integration of artistic elements encourages students to think outside the box, experiment, and explore new possibilities. This creative mindset prepares them to tackle complex problems and come up with innovative solutions in various domains.

3. Fostering Critical Thinking and Problem-Solving Skills
STEAM education promotes critical thinking and problem-solving skills by engaging students in hands-on activities and real-world projects. Through inquiry-based learning and experimentation, students learn to analyze information, evaluate different perspectives, and develop logical reasoning skills. These skills are essential for success in the modern workforce.

4. Enhancing Collaboration and Communication Abilities
Collaboration and effective communication are vital skills in today's interconnected world. STEAM education encourages students to work in teams, solving problems together and sharing ideas. By engaging in group projects, students develop strong interpersonal skills, learn to communicate their thoughts and findings clearly, and understand the value of teamwork.
